Carpentry framing services involve constructing the structural framework of a building or addition, typically using wood or other materials suited for load-bearing purposes. This process includes measuring, cutting, and assembling components such as studs, beams, joists, and headers to create a solid skeleton for walls, floors, and ceilings. Proper framing ensures that the structure is stable, level, and capable of supporting the weight of the building’s other elements. Skilled carpenters focus on precision and alignment to provide a foundation that meets both safety standards and design specifications.

The overview below groups typical Carpentry Framing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- For minor framing repairs or adjustments,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the scope and materials needed.

Basic Framing Projects - Standard framing for new walls or small additions generally costs $1,200 to $3,000. Most projects of this size stay within this middle range, with fewer exceeding higher amounts.

Major Renovations - Larger, more complex framing work such as room additions or structural modifications can range from $4,000 to $10,000. These projects often involve detailed planning and materials, leading to higher costs.

Full Replacement - Complete framing replacement for significant structures can reach $15,000 or more. Such extensive work is less common and typically falls into the highest cost bracket among local service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of framing services do local contractors provide? Local contractors typically offer wall framing, roof truss installation, floor joist framing, and custom wood framing for various building projects.

How do I know if framing services are suitable for my project? A professional framing contractor can assess your project’s requirements and determine if framing services are appropriate based on the scope and design.

What materials are commonly used in framing projects? Common materials include dimensional lumber, engineered wood products, and metal framing components, depending on the specific needs of the project.

Can local contractors handle both residential and commercial framing jobs? Yes, many local service providers are experienced in framing for both residential structures and commercial buildings.

What should I consider when choosing a framing contractor? When selecting a contractor, consider their experience with similar projects, reputation, and ability to work within your project's specifications.
